随着互联网技术的发展,网络已经成为我们生活和工作中不可或缺的一部分。网络拓扑设计是网络技术的重要组成部分,直接影响着网络的性能、可靠性和安全性。本文将从多个角度分析网络拓扑设计对网络的影响。
一、网络拓扑结构
网络拓扑结构是指网络中各个节点和连接的物理排列方式。网络的拓扑结构直接影响着网络的性能和可靠性。常见的网络拓扑结构有星型、总线型、树型、网状、环型等。
1.星型拓扑结构
星型拓扑结构是将所有的设备连接到一个中心节点上,所有的节点都依赖中心节点进行通信。星型拓扑结构的优点是易于维护和管理,但是中心节点如果出现问题将导致整个网络瘫痪。
2.总线型拓扑结构
总线型拓扑结构是将所有的设备连接到一条主线上,所有的节点都共享主线进行通信。总线型拓扑结构的优点是成本低,但是一旦主线出现问题,整个网络都将受到影响。
3.树型拓扑结构
树型拓扑结构是将各个子网络连接成一个层次结构,并将其与根节点相连。树型拓扑结构的优点是易于扩展和管理,但是单点故障可能会影响到整个网络的正常运转。
4.网状拓扑结构
网状拓扑结构是将各个节点直接连接在一起,形成一个网状结构。网状拓扑结构的优点是具有高度的冗余和可靠性,但是成本较高且不易于管理。
5.环型拓扑结构
环型拓扑结构是将各个节点依次连接在一个环形结构上。环型拓扑结构的优点是具有高度的可靠性和性能,但是单点故障可能会导致整个环路无法进行通信。
二、网络安全
拓扑结构的选择对网络的安全性有着深远的影响。合理的拓扑结构可以提高网络的安全性,降低网络的风险。
1.物理安全
拓扑结构的选择可能会影响网络的物理安全。例如,星型拓扑结构容易被攻击者发现中心节点,并对中心节点进行攻击。而网状拓扑结构则可以提供更加分散的通信路径,从而降低网络的攻击风险。
2.逻辑安全
逻辑安全是指网络在逻辑上避免受到攻击的能力。拓扑结构的不同可能会导致不同的逻辑安全风险。例如,总线型拓扑结构容易发生信号被窃听的风险。
三、网络性能
1.延迟
网络的延迟是指数据从源节点到目标节点的传输时间。不同的拓扑结构会导致不同的延迟。例如,星型拓扑结构的延迟较低,而树型和环型拓扑结构的延迟较高。
2.吞吐量
吞吐量是指网络在单位时间内能够传输的数据量。不同的拓扑结构会影响网络的吞吐量。例如,网状拓扑结构可以提供更多的通信路径,从而提高网络的吞吐量。
3.可扩展性
可扩展性是指网络在用户数量增加时仍能够保持良好的性能。不同的拓扑结构会对网络的可扩展性造成不同的影响。例如,树型拓扑结构中的根节点可能会成为瓶颈,影响网络的可扩展性。
总之,网络拓扑设计对网络的影响主要表现在网络的拓扑结构、安全性和性能三个方面。合理的拓扑结构可以提高网络的性能和可靠性,降低网络的风险。本文介绍了常见的网络拓扑结构,并分析了不同拓扑结构对网络的影响。在进行网络拓扑设计时,需要综合考虑多个因素,选择最合适的拓扑结构。
扫码咨询 领取资料